Output f1efb1e40cd6066aadd9b636e2103189071cb68801deb8465915c2a2ee8224d8:2

value
58624596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55f88f6f94ce6a2a7db3de7df27d219c166bb76 OP_EQUAL
address
MQSAz3L1fPj9aCavjaB573wVdNTVvUte3P
transaction
f1efb1e40cd6066aadd9b636e2103189071cb68801deb8465915c2a2ee8224d8
spent
true